Event Description
|
At the start of a supraventricular tachycardia procedure, the amplifier booted to a solid amber color which caused a delay.Multiple reboots were attempted but issue persisted.The amplifier was rebooted with no connections in the front of the amplifier, but issue persisted.One final reboot was attempted with no cables except the power cable, which did not resolve the issue.The procedure was completed using a non abbott system (carto).

Manufacturer Narrative
|
Additional information: d9, g3, h2, h3 one ensite x amplifier was received for evaluation.Visual inspection revealed the front ports, rear ports, and chassis were free of physical damage.For evaluation purposes the port 3 and port 4 small form-factor pluggable (sfp) were temporarily exchanged.The amplifier was powered on and never initiated, then went to a solid orange ¿not-ready¿ light emitting diode (led) status.This indicated the amplifier did not start the power-on-self-test (post).It was noted that a nios message appeared against slot 3 cardiamp board, as well as a sideplane ¿state unknown¿ message.The device history record was reviewed to ensure that each manufacturing and inspection operation was performed.No non-conformances associated with the reported event were identified.Based on the information provided to abbott and the investigation performed, the root cause was attributed to the cardiamp board in slot 3 and the sideplane.
